Course Content

• Urban Plant Ecology: Adaptation and resilience in the built environment
• Plant Genetics and Urban Evolution: Investigating genetic diversity and its role in adaptation to urban stressors
• Urban Phytogeography and Biogeography: Distribution patterns of plants in urban areas
• Urban Plant Physiology and Stress Tolerance: Responses to pollution, drought, and heat island effects
• Urban Plant Conservation and Biodiversity: Strategies for maintaining and restoring plant diversity in cities
• Landscape Genetics and Urban Green Spaces: Applying landscape genetics principles to understand plant movements and gene flow in urban landscapes
• Applied Urban Plant Evolution: Utilizing evolutionary principles for urban green infrastructure design
• Urban Ecosystem Services and Plant Evolution: The role of plants in air quality, carbon sequestration, and human well-being
• Citizen Science and Urban Plant Monitoring: Engaging the public in data collection and analysis of urban plant populations
